ABSTRACT:
A system and method for increasing the robustness of an optical ring network having a plurality of ring nodes. Optical data traffic is transmitted between a plurality of ring nodes via optical links. A first optical cross connect switch and a second optical cross connect switch are coupled to an alternate network. The first optical cross connect switch is coupled to a first ring node. The second optical cross connect switch is coupled to a second ring node. When a failure is detected in the first optical link, then the first optical cross connect switch couples the first ring node to an alternate path of the alternate network, and the second optical cross connect switch couples the second ring node to the alternate path, such that optical data traffic is transmitted between the first ring node and the second ring node via the alternate path.
